Hocus Pocus Gifts
Products 1 - 6 of 6

Sale - 17%
£52.99£43.99-£52.99*

Sale - 77%
£61.99£14.99-£21.99

Sale - 17%
£52.99£43.99-£52.99*

£70.99-£79.99

£61.99-£87.99

Sale - 50%
£52.99£26.99-£35.99
Products 1 - 6 of 6
Filter